RETIRING COTT’S OFFER TO HELP OTHERS

By William Pound

THANKS: David Cotterill

FORMER Wales international David Cotterill, who played for a host of Football League clubs, says he plans to start a new chapter in his life helping others after announcing his retirement from playing football.
Cotterill won 24 caps for Wales and played over 400 games in a club career which took in spells at Bristol City, Wigan Athletic, Sheffield United, Swansea, Portsmouth, Barnsley, Doncaster and Birmingham City.
